Wearing a cold water swimming hat while swimming in chilly temperatures helps to retain body heat, prevent heat loss through the head, and improve overall comfort and safety in cold water.

At the same depth the pressure is greater at sea because salt water is denser than fresh water.
To create a DIY water park in your backyard, you can start by setting up a slip and slide, inflatable pool, water sprinklers, water balloons, and a small water slide. Make sure to have proper safety measures in place, such as supervision for children and non-slip surfaces. You can also add water toys and games to enhance the fun experience. Remember to regularly check and maintain the water quality for cleanliness and safety.
